The Patient Registration Specialist is often the first-person patients meet as they pre-register or arrive for medical services in a ProMedica clinic, lab, inpatient, outpatient, or emergency department. People in this role perform tasks such as validating insurance, posting payments, securing registration, billing information, and answering questions from patients, visitors, or other staff.
The Patient Registration Specialist complies with HIPPA guidelines and privacy practices, patient confidentiality, and patient rights. You will be an active team member and prioritize responsibilities to complete daily work and assist in training new staff as needed. You will review all work to ensure it complies with system quality assurance policies.

ProMedica is a mission-driven, not-for-profit health care organization headquartered in Toledo, Ohio. It serves communities across nine states and provides a range of services, including acute and ambulatory care, a dental plan, and academic business lines. ProMedica owns and operates 10 hospitals and has an affiliated interest in one additional hospital. The organization employs over 1,300 health care providers through ProMedica Physicians and has more than 2,300 physicians and advanced practice providers with privileges. Committed to its mission of improving health and well-being, ProMedica has received national recognition for its clinical excellence and its initiatives to address social determinants of health.
